Primary Purpose
Provides direct care in industrial setting performing post-offer physicals, drug and alcohol screenings, First Aid, wellness education and OSHA compliance. Provides leadership and oversight in the Medical department as needed. Works in conjunction with the Occupational Health Manager on worker's compensation case management. Exemplifies excellent customer service and builds rapport with employees. Understands unit policies and procedures and can fill in for the Occupational Health Manager when needed.
Hours: Per -Diem, 8 - 16 hrs. Per week, weekdays and evening with occasional overnights and Saturdays.
